The ED has carried out searches at multiple locations in Patiala and Mohali, with premises linked to DM Web Based Solutions and Flying Feathers among those under investigation.
The operations began on Tuesday night and continued into Wednesday morning, while the agency had not officially disclosed the full details of the investigation or the specific allegations behind the action at the time of reporting.
Premises Searched in Patiala and Mohali
In Patiala, ED officials searched premises in Urban Estate Phase II, including establishments linked to DM Web Based Solutions and Flying Feathers. Officials reportedly examined documents, computer data and other records during the operation. Two establishments in the area were also reported to have been sealed during the searches.
Another ED team reached Plot No. 2010 in IT City, Sector 82A, Mohali, where records linked to the ongoing investigation were examined. The searches reportedly began late at night and continued for several hours.
Initial reports have linked the Patiala operation to alleged fake call centre activities and possible cyber fraud connections. However, the precise nature of the case and the role of any individuals or companies were yet to be clarified by the ED.

Political Claims Surface Over ED Action
The searches also drew political attention. Shiromani Akali Dal leader Bikram Singh Majithia referred to the ED action involving Flying Feathers and DM Web Based Solutions. He alleged that activities were being carried out under the cover of IELTS classes and raised claims about possible fraud involving people abroad.
Reports also suggested that the investigation could involve links to other individuals and business establishments. However, no official ED statement confirming the identity or involvement of any IPS officer in the current searches was available at the time of reporting.
Details of Seizures and Arrests Awaited
The latest operation follows several ED investigations in Punjab and neighbouring areas involving alleged financial irregularities and suspected money laundering activity. The agency’s Chandigarh office had conducted searches at eight premises across Chandigarh, Mohali, Punjab and Madhya Pradesh in August in a separate case.
Further information about the present Patiala and Mohali searches, including whether any seizures or arrests were made and the exact offences under investigation, was awaited from the Enforcement Directorate.
